Head of the Geothermal Research Center (GRC) and geothermal lecturer at the Department of Geological Engineering, Faculty of Engineering, UGM, Pri Utami, assessed that the Mount Ungaran Geothermal Power Plant (PLTP) has the potential to strengthen Central Java's electricity supply.

JPNN.com, JAKARTA - Head of Geothermal Research Center (GRC) and lecturer of geothermal heat at the Department of Geological Engineering Faculty of Gadjah Mada University (UGM) Pri Utami assessed that Gunung Ungaran Geothermal Power Plant (PLTP) has the potential to strengthen Central Java's electricity supply because it is able to generate electricity stably from clean energy sources.
